#DA18BA Hex Color Code

#DA18BA

The Hexadecimal Color #DA18BA is a contrast shade of Deep Pink. #DA18BA RGB value is rgb(218, 24, 186). RGB Color Model of #DA18BA consists of 85% red, 9% green and 72% blue. HSL color Mode of #DA18BA has 310°(degrees) Hue, 80% Saturation and 47% Lightness. #DA18BA color has an wavelength of 424.81481n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DA18BA is #FF33C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DA18BA is #D1B. The Closest Color to #DA18BA is #FF1493. Official Name of #DA18BA Hex Code is Hollywood Cerise.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DA18BA is 0 Cyan 89 Magenta 15 Yellow 15 Black and #DA18BA CMY is 0, 89, 15.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#DA18BA is hsl(310,80,47,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(310, 89, 85).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#DA18BA is 38.1, 19.11, 48.13.
Hex8 Value of #DA18BA is #DA18BAFF. Decimal Value of #DA18BA is 14293178 and Octal Value of #DA18BA is 66414272. Binary Value of #DA18BA is 11011010, 11000, 10111010 and Android of #DA18BA is 4292483258 / 0xffda18ba.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#DA18BA is 0.362, 0.181, 0.181 and YIQ Color Space of #DA18BA is 100.474, 63.554, 91.4454.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#DA18BA is 28.31, 5.93, 47.71.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#DA18BA is 50.82, 80.67, -37.15.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#DA18BA is 50.82, 83.9, -67.21.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#DA18BA is 50.82, 88.81, 335.27. Hunter Lab variable of #DA18BA is 43.71, 79.07, -34.68.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DA18BA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
